Transaction 516e2fe4d39a74b0ee8fe0416426150f0f5597a6637ca55bb0be3ff45e6ae994
4 Input
2 Outputs
- 516e2fe4d39a74b0ee8fe0416426150f0f5597a6637ca55bb0be3ff45e6ae994:0
- 516e2fe4d39a74b0ee8fe0416426150f0f5597a6637ca55bb0be3ff45e6ae994:1
value 1075183
address 1K9Fgy54b63KFUWZeDJpAdwtax5yP5D2Y8
value 99980000
address 1PPfGWTc58UmYF9UtQLEQND82fceAPrrmk